ad5820: Voice coil motor controller
authorSakari Ailus <sakari.ailus@nokia.com>
Fri, 31 Oct 2008 11:36:22 +0000 (13:36 +0200)
committerPali Rohár <pali.rohar@gmail.com>
Sun, 22 Sep 2013 17:05:35 +0000 (19:05 +0200)
commit661caf226fee7a8f54ac3559787f7474b4917f82
tree5db3fcdcf6c8000b2381c9f8b7b20c6876246c11
parent127d877eab4f0d33ca30639bc69ac5f2186fd637
ad5820: Voice coil motor controller

Squashed from the following upstream commits:

ad5820: Add driver
ad5820: change focus control name to standard
ad5820: move header file to include/media due to public kernel interface
ad5820: Compile fix.
ad5820: remove control id definitions and move to include/media
ad5820: Power up changes.
ad5820: suspend/resume support
ad5820: Fix suspend
ad5820: update to new power management model
ad5820: map V4L2_POWER_STANDBY to V4L2_POWER_ON
ad5820: Convert to v4l2_subdev model
ad5820: Use media_entity for power
ad5820: Include linux/slab.h.
ad5820: Update to the latest v4l2_subdev API
ad5820: Update as per changes in platform data
ad5820: Move VANA handling to regulator framework
ad5820: Use the control framework
ad5820: Drop chip ident numbers
ad5820: Power the device on/off on open/close
ad5820: Free control handler on device removal
ad5820: Move open/close file operations to internal ops structure
ad5820: Replace core.s_config operation with internal.registered
ad5820: Do not include mach/io.h and mach/gpio.h files

Signed-off-by: Sakari Ailus <sakari.ailus@maxwell.research.nokia.com>
Signed-off-by: Tuukka Toivonen <tuukka.o.toivonen@nokia.com>
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Signed-off-by: David Cohen <david.cohen@nokia.com>
Signed-off-by: Pali Rohár <pali.rohar@gmail.com>
drivers/media/i2c/ad5820.c [new file with mode: 0644]
include/media/ad5820.h [new file with mode: 0644]